How Common Is The Last Name Norking?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 4,532,898th most commonly held last name in the world It is held by approximately 1 in 383,555,048 people. The surname is primarily found in Europe, where 74 percent of Norking reside; 68 percent reside in Northern Europe and 63 percent reside in Scandinavia.

The surname is most commonly occurring in Sweden, where it is borne by 7 people, or 1 in 1,406,680. In Sweden Norking is most common in: Skåne County, where 100 percent are found. Besides Sweden it is found in 5 countries. It is also found in Denmark, where 26 percent are found and Brazil, where 21 percent are found.
